About this House

Fully Furnished and Utilities are included in monthly rate.

Private retreat in North Hudson, fully updated with a Cottage vibe. On the outside, natural stone has been added to the foundation and is accented by beautifully planned perennial gardens surrounding the house. A deck with screened-in gazebo, leads to a brick patio and path to the all-natural stone waterfall. Beyond the waterfall is a woodland garden complete with tree swing, which offers serenity and enjoyment for all ages.

From the inviting front porch, enter the ceramic tiled foyer, with mini-mud room off the garage. Hardwood floors and 3" crown molding accent the living and dining room. The kitchen was completely remodeled with white beadboard trim, subway tile, marble countertops, farmhouse sink and all new hardware and lighting. Kitchen appliances are all stainless steel and includes a Jenn-Air double oven and high-end vinyl flooring.

Step down into the family room with beamed ceiling, brick fireplace surrounded by bookshelves, and French doors leading out to your own private retreat including large screened in gazebo on raised deck. From the deck, follow the stone path to the waterfall and on through the woodland garden, complete with Hosta, Rose of Sharon trees, Song of Solomon, Creeping Thyme, Apple trees, Japanese pachysandra, wildflowers and more! The all-natural stone path will lead you to the river rock pond, complete with a dock, Lilly pads, water celery, Tiger Lilies, and more!

Upstairs, you'll find a HUGE master bedroom with walk in closet and skylighted bath, 3 additional bedrooms that share a full bath with jetted tub and separate shower.

Downstairs you'll find a semi-finished basement with drop ceiling, recessed lighting, April Aire whole house humidifier, washer and dryer and tons of storage.
